In the modern landscape of digital accounting, the transition from manual ledgers to Automated Accounting Systems (AAS) has redefined financial management. Among these systems, Tally has emerged as a cornerstone for small to medium enterprises (SMEs) globally. However, the utility of such software is only as robust as the "verification" of the data entered. The concept of being "verified" in Tally refers to the rigorous process of audit, reconciliation, and authentication that ensures financial reports reflect the true health of a business.
